Lubricate

英式发音:['luːbrɪkeɪt] or ['lubrɪket] 美式发音

    (verb.) make slippery or smooth through the application of a lubricant; 'lubricate the key'.

    (verb.) apply a lubricant to; 'lubricate my car'.

    (verb.) have lubricating properties; 'the liquid in this can lubricates well'.
